- #Javascript download file from url how to
- #Javascript download file from url update
- #Javascript download file from url code
- #Javascript download file from url download
#Javascript download file from url download
In this way, we can control the download inside the application and we can react depending on its status. In the second, we manage the download internally and send it to the browser only when the download is complete. This method is the preferred way when the application does not have to perform certain actions based on the load state. In this, we simply forward the download process to the browser to manage it natively.
![javascript download file from url javascript download file from url](https://codingshiksha.com/wp-content/uploads/2020/12/Screenshot_101.png)
#Javascript download file from url update
Wrap upĮach of the above methods represents an update over the previous method. After the file is completely downloaded, it will be sent to the browser and then it will be instantly saved to disk. Notice in the GIF above that we have the same behavior as for the second method, only now we can monitor progress. We are using XMLHttpRequest over Fetch because at the moment speaking Fetch API doesn’t provide an interface for progress measurement, while XMLHttpRequest does. The third method is similar to the second method, we are still going to use Blob and createObjectURL, but instead of using the Fetch API, we will use XMLHttpRequest. Show a message, send a request to the back-end render a new page, and so on… Method III However, the problem is that because the download takes place inside our application, the user may think that nothing happened when he clicked and therefore it is up to us to manage large file downloads by implementing the measurement of progress.Īt the same time, this method is useful when we need to perform certain actions inside our application once the file has completed downloaded. With this method now we are able to download any type of file regardless of the origin server. Once that browser window appears and we click save, the file is automatically saved on our computer.
![javascript download file from url javascript download file from url](https://images.gamersyde.com/image_stream-43090-4340_0002.jpg)
Notice in the GIF above that once we click the Download button, nothing seems to happen, because the download takes place as an asynchronous task in our application and once it is completed, it will be passed to the browser. If the value is omitted, the original filename is used. However, the user will still be able to change the name when the native download window appears, but the name we provided will be the default.
![javascript download file from url javascript download file from url](https://kodular-community.s3.dualstack.eu-west-1.amazonaws.com/original/3X/b/e/be7d261b0a4c4a5e616e38c0e8fb35dd34082982.png)
Therefore if we want to download the file with a specific name, we can control this using this attribute. The first and the simplest method implies creating an anchor HTML element that has the download attribute.īy definition, the download attribute specifies that the target (the file specified in the href attribute) will be downloaded when a user clicks on the hyperlink.Īlso with this download attribute we can specify the new name of the file after it is downloaded.
#Javascript download file from url how to
How to Download File using Axios Vue JS?.
![javascript download file from url javascript download file from url](https://i.stack.imgur.com/VtGOK.png)
#Javascript download file from url code
Vue.js Download Files From URL Using Axios and Javascript Source Code bellow code: